Jessica and I sat down to talk about several stories from the past week involving religion and politics.

They included:

— The “Activist Mommy” who can’t handle an article in Teen Vogue.

— An Appeals Court decision saying Christian prayers led by elected officials is unconstitutional.

Eugene Peterson, the Bible scholar who inched toward support of marriage equality, then ran back to the other side.

Pat Robertson‘s useless interview with Donald Trump.

— The “gay Muslim” marriage that’s more heartbreaking than inspiring.

— Why Republicans dislike higher education.

— The worst possible explanation for why God allows suffering.

— The growth of the Flat Earth movement.

— How Jesus apparently needs gluten to transubstantiate.
